Overview

Server processors are high-performance CPUs designed specifically for enterprise-level workloads. They power data centers, cloud platforms, and mission-critical applications that require reliability, scalability, and consistent performance.

 

Key Features

Server processors are built to handle multi-threaded workloads, support large memory capacities, and operate continuously under heavy loads. They often include advanced features such as error-correcting code (ECC) memory support, virtualization capabilities, and enhanced security features.

Use Cases

  • Data centers and cloud computing
  • Virtualization and containerized environments
  • Database management systems
  • High-performance computing (HPC)

Benefits

These processors deliver exceptional performance, stability, and scalability. They are optimized for 24/7 operation, making them ideal for critical business applications.

FAQ's

 

Q1: What makes server processors different from desktop CPUs?

Ans: They support higher workloads, larger memory capacities, and enterprise features like ECC memory.

 

Q2: Which processor should I choose for my server?

Ans: It depends on workload requirements, number of cores, and compatibility with your server hardware.

 

Q3: Are server processors energy-efficient?

Ans: Yes, modern server CPUs are designed to balance performance with power efficiency.
